Horizon Europe Cluster 5 — Climate, Energy and Mobility

Next-Generation Battery Concepts

Funds ten €4.8M research projects developing safer, cheaper and higher-performing battery concepts for mobility, grids and industry.

This two-stage topic supports battery concepts that can strengthen European competitiveness, green energy use and energy storage. Applicants choose among low-cost batteries for electric mobility or stationary storage, high-performance batteries for aviation or other demanding mobility, and durable advanced materials and cell concepts for grid or energy-intensive industrial storage.

Two-stage research support for next-generation battery concepts across three areas: low-cost lithium-ion or sodium-ion batteries, high-performance batteries for aviation and mobility, or durable advanced materials and cells for stationary storage. Projects address scalability, manufacturability, sustainability, safety, diagnostics and market relevance, reaching TRL 4-5.
